Output 56709e97a53c0d8110721fd5d9357f72f0672dcc9e33819907a9b754e01c9112:1

value
4108395
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95d463332546465fefc6ac11359ca73515e0e3fa OP_EQUAL
address
3FMF34w9DWCYyMiYT34u7Pc1hZTZTTkgBW
transaction
56709e97a53c0d8110721fd5d9357f72f0672dcc9e33819907a9b754e01c9112
spent
true